Doughboys doughnuts are my absolute fav donut place in Melb! I always stop by heading home from work as their doughnuts have never failed to make my day. They come up with new flavours every now and then and they never disappoint. My favourites are crullers and old fashioned butter flavour. Crullers are super soft and airy on the airy and it’s always very enjoyable. All the other flavours come second (tight tie)… They recently came out with tiramisu and that’s AMAZING!!! The coffee custardy filling is super creamy and not too sweet, complemented well with the slightly sweeter outer coating of the doughnut.

Doughboys make quality doughnuts, you might read that they are “pricey” but you get a lot for what you pay for. Their flavours are unique and more artisan than your standard donut king. They remake batches during the day, but if you go too late in the afternoon, you might risk missing your favourite. Doughnuts are delicious and bready, not light and fluffy, made with quality ingredients, the standout was the banoffee pie. They also serve coffee, with outdoor seating, and limited indoor seating.
